Haven of greenery and peace

This barn was built by my grandfather after the Second World War. Stone, wood and lime were the main materials used. It is with a lot of heart and work that we restored this barn with respect for the premises, the environment and our ancestors. For the paintings, I made lime-based whitewash, stucco and tadelakt. The ceiling beams are colored with walnut stain, covered with natural hard oil.
